QUOTE(mitodna @ Jul 25 2016, 07:24 PM)
Noob question, if "received" cash rebate from before the statement, the it is safe to not to pay the retail transaction? Statement out soon

It will be - once the statement out, sorry, really noob, first time got -....

Thanks
*
What do you mean by "not to pay the retail transaction"? unsure.gif
Oh got it, negative transactions is it? That means your cash back is greater than retail transactions?

CIMB is very tricky, for safety purpose just see the amount shown on statement balance. If it's negative then don't need to pay but if it's not, please pay and don't deduct the cash back yourself. You might be slapped with interest due to short payment, CIMB doesn't recognize cash back as "payment".
